Mortgage REITs (mREITs) provide financing to real estate owners and operators, either directly in the form of mortgages or other types of real estate loans, or indirectly through investments in mortgage-backed securities. Hybrid REITs use investment strategies of both equity REITs and mortgage REITs. REITs are classified …Web

REITs invest in the majority of real estate property types, including offices, apartment buildings, warehouses, retail centers, medical facilities, data centers, cell towers, infrastructure and hotels. Most REITs focus on a particular property type, but some hold multiple types of properties in their portfolios. ... Dec 1, 2023 · Invest at least 75% of total assets in real estate or cash. Receive at least 75% of gross income from real estate, such as real property rents, interest on mortgages financing the real property or ... In late October, OPI reported (10/30/2023) financial results for the third quarter of fiscal 2023. The occupancy rate dipped sequentially from 90.6% to 89.8% and normalized funds from operations (FFO) per share fell -8%, from $1.11 to $1.02.

A real estate investment trust ( REIT, pronounced "reet" [1]) is a company that owns, and in most cases operates, income-producing real estate. REITs own many types of commercial real estate, including office and apartment buildings, warehouses, hospitals, shopping centers, hotels and commercial forests. Real estate investment trusts (“REITs”) allow individuals to invest in large-scale, income-producing real estate. A REIT is a company that owns and typically operates income-producing real estate or related assets.
